Registering your trip with the Nicaragua embassy is crucial for ensuring your safety and maintaining effective communication during your stay abroad. In the event of natural disasters, like earthquakes or hurricanes, having your trip registered allows the embassy to quickly identify your whereabouts, ensuring you receive timely information and support. Similarly, during episodes of political unrest, embassy registration provides an essential communication channel, allowing for assistance and evacuation if necessary. Furthermore, in cases of medical emergencies, having your trip recorded can facilitate prompt care and potential medical evacuation. Overall, trip registration serves as a safety net, enhancing the embassy’s ability to protect and support Nicaraguan citizens abroad.
Can the Nicaragua emb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
Yes, the Nicaragua embassy can provide assistance in legal matters by offering guidance on local laws and connecting you with local legal resources.
What should I do if I lose my Nicaragua passport in Saudi Arabia?
If you lose your Nicaragua passport, promptly report the loss to the local authorities and contact the Nicaragua embassy in Saudi Arabia for assistance in obtaining a replacement.
Does the Nicaragua embassy provide notary services?
Yes, the embassy offers notary services for various documents, including affidavits and powers of attorney, for Nicaraguan citizens in Saudi Arabia.
How can I contact the embassy in case of an emergency?
You can contact the Nicaragua embassy through their official phone number or email, which are available on their official website.
What types of visas are available for foreigners?
The embassy provides information on various visa types, including tourist, student, and work visas for foreigners wishing to travel to Nicaragua.
